Description:

Series 4000 Annunciator panels provide clear indication of all incoming calls. Anodized aluminum finish. Surface or flush mountable. 10, 15 or 25 LED indicators per row are provided for visual alert; an electronic tone, for audible alert. Two tone board operations are available: the (TG) for single status and the (AT) for dual or triple status systems.

Operation:

When an associated call station is activated, the LED will illuminate. Panel also includes a Hi-lo tone switch, lamp check switch and power indicator for optimum operations.

Options:

Tone Options: Two options are available, one for single status and another for multiple status systems.

Mounting:

Available in flush wall-mounted or optional oak finished surface or sloping desktop enclosures.

WE - wall enclosure for surface mounting.

SE - sloping enclosure for desk top mounting.

Engineering Specifications:

The contractor shall furnish and install the CORNELL A-4000/XX series annunciator panel. The faceplate shall be made of anodized aluminum and provide designation strips. Indicators shall be light emitting diodes (LEDs); incandescent lamps are not acceptable. The faceplate shall feature hi-lo tone switch and lamp test switch. LED power indicator provided on dual status panels. The unit shall be (surface)(flush)(rack) mounted. The tone options shall be (single) (dual) or (triple).

Technical Information:

  • Power Requirements: 24VDC
  • Operating Environment: 50-120°F Indoor Non-condensing
  • Wiring: #22 AWG Minimum, #18 AWG Minimum for Power
